Since the weekend, an alleged leaked teaser of a new Silent Hill game has surfaced. This is said to contain the reveal date of the upcoming title.

After Hideo Kojima’s Silent Hills was shelved seven years ago, fans have been waiting for a sequel to the series. Now it almost looks like the long wait might finally be over. A teaser is circulating on Twitter that sets the reveal date for 12 July. The authenticity of the leak cannot yet be verified, so we’d better keep our anticipation in check.

According to the Twitter account Rebs Gaming, the leak was first said to have been shared on a Japanese forum. However, that post has now been removed. According to the leaker, the clip was shown during a Konami shareholder meeting. However, Rebs Gaming also states that it has not yet received any official confirmation affirming the authenticity of this Silent Hill teaser.

Accordingly, there is nothing we can do but wait for July 12.
